War

The medic bent down to examine me,
He asked me what was wrong,
I could see that he,
Was kind and brave and strong.

Just a short time ago,
I was walking with my mate,
Until we were ambushed
Now what is my fate?

My life flashed before me,
I saw my children and wife,
They were smiling at me,
From our perfect life.

I wonder if my life,
Will ever be the same.
If I’ll ever get back home,
The enemy is to blame!
